>> yes, also another topic: I use zfs. Will backuppc handle snapshots in
>>> the future?
>> If someone implements it, sure. However, many features of ZFS are
>> already handled in BackupPC, so that is perhaps redundant work. My
>> suggestion would be to look into using zfs tools natively to transfer
>> the pool without BackupPC's knowledge.
>
> Hmmm... but this implements the knowledge of zfs and all related things.
> Thats the reason why i like Backuppc - easy to use, easys interface,
> quick and ready - nice overviews.
>
> You wrote, that backuppc already handle many futures of zfs!? How can i
> use that?
>

It already does it automatically; as deduplication, compression, 
versioning and so forth. Like you said - it's ready and works as it is, 
not depending on a specific filesystem.
